Updates to your enhanced conversions settings

Enhanced conversions for web and enhanced conversions for leads will soon be combined into a single on/off setting. This also means you no longer need to choose a single implementation method like the Google tag, Google tag Manager or the Google Ads API. Google Ads will simultaneously accept user-provided data from website tags, and API connections.

What this means

  • Starting in April 2026: Google Ads will simultaneously accept user-provided data from website tags, Data Manager, and API connections. This can improve the accuracy of your conversion tracking and optimize your campaign bidding.
  • Starting in June 2026: Enhanced conversions for web and leads will be combined into a single feature with a simple on/off switch. You will no longer see different method selections in your Google Ads account.

Impact on your account

  • Existing users: No action is required from you to remain active with enhanced conversions. You’ll be automatically migrated to the new unified status if you have previously agreed to Google’s customer data terms.
  • New users: If you haven’t set up enhanced conversions, you can turn on enhanced conversions at the account or conversion action levels. Learn more About enhanced conversions.
  • Opting out: You can still opt out of enhanced conversions at the conversion action level at any time.

Turn on enhanced conversions

Account level settings

To turn on enhanced conversions at the account level, follow the steps below:

  1. Go to Settings within the Goals menu Goals Icon.
  2. Expand the Customer data use panel.
  3. Check “Turn on enhanced conversions”.
  4. Check “Turn on conversion-based customer lists” to let Google use user-provided data to create customer lists for your account based on your conversions.
  5. Select Agree and save.
  6. Review the data terms, then select Agree and continue.

Conversion level settings

To turn on enhanced conversions at the conversion action level, follow the steps below:

  1. Go to Summary within the Goals menu Goals Icon.
  2. Select + Create conversion action.
  3. In the data sources panel, select “Conversions offline” by checking the box.
  4. Select Edit data sources.
  5. Choose “Skip this step and set up a data source later”.
  6. In the “Customer data use” panel, check “Turn on enhanced conversions”.
  7. Check “Turn on conversion-based customer lists” to let Google use user-provided data to create customer lists for your account based on your conversions.
  8. Select Agree and continue.
  9. Review the data terms, then select Agree and continue.
